Kiev PR man Andrei Demartino, who advised the late prime minister of the autonomy Vasily Dzharty during the time of Viktor Yanukovych, announced the presence of weapons caches in Crimea among supporters of Ukraine.

Demartino wrote about this on his blog, questioning the FSB’s data about the saboteurs’ attempt to break through the border into Crimea.
